Summary Description:

This position is a remote opportunity, with office space at our Columbia, MD main office available as desired.

The ideal candidate will have 5-7 years of hands-on, accounting operations experience to include “full-cycle" A/P, A/R-Billing, Job Cost Accounting, financial statements, bank reconciliations, and monthly closing.

The duties of this position include but are not limited to:

  • Maintaining complete control of the balance sheet
  • Creating job cost and contract reporting for Government contracts
  • Being responsible for timing and quality of closing process/cycle, preparing complex financial reporting
  • Preparing and reviewing monthly financials and reporting packages to include forecast schedules and dashboards
  • Conducting research & analysis, billed and unbilled receivable analysis and revenue recognition
  • Developing and managing indirect rate structures, assists with the preparation of budgets, forecasts, incurred cost submissions, and other duties as required, handles inquiries and information requests
  • Serving as a resource to others in the resolution of complex problems
  • Supporting assigned clients with cost-effective, accurate, and compliant accounting services at an advanced level
  • Managing relationships with clients and auditors
  • Tasking and deliverables handled with little to no direct supervision

Experience working for or with government contractors and Unanet, CostPoint, and/or Quickbooks is required. This is a great opportunity for a highly motivated individual. We seek a results-oriented, energetic person with superior accounting skills.

Qualified candidates will have the following characteristics:

  • 5-7 years of progressive accounting experience required; proficiency with general ledger, job costing, and GAAP compliance is a must
  • Highly organized. Tedious about record-keeping, file organization, etc.
  • Able to manage and ensure the quality of work of support staff
  • Able to handle competing deliverables with various levels of complexity.
  • Excellent communication and customer service skills
  • Travel to customer locations required for customers in the local area
  • Extremely computer literate, strong MS Excel, MS Word skills are a must. Experience with Office 365 is a plus
  • Demonstrated ability to manage projects within cost and schedule
  • Strong problem-solving aptitude required; must be able to analyze client needs & leverage accounting systems effectively to create value for customers
  • Motivated – A self-starter with the ability to multi-task, problem solves, and takes initiative
  • Strong understanding of Government contracting including compliance with the FAR, DCAA Compliance, and indirect rates

Overall, candidates must be highly accurate, have superior written and oral communication skills, and be extremely organized. We value our clients and this individual must offer great customer service.
